What this Trial Is About

This research aims to understand how smartphone addiction influences neck pain severity and the mechanical properties of neck muscles in healthy young adults aged 18 to 30. It compares two groups: those identified as smartphone addicted and those without addiction, using validated addiction scales and objective muscle assessments. The study focuses on the relationship between smartphone use, posture, and musculoskeletal health in this population. Participants undergo a one-time observational assessment including questionnaires such as the Smartphone Addiction Scale - Short Form (SAS-SF) and Social Media Addiction Scale (SMAS) to determine addiction status. Muscle characteristics including tone, stiffness, and elasticity are measured with the MyotonPRO device, and pressure pain threshold is assessed using a handheld algometer. No treatments or interventions are given, as the study is purely observational. During the study visit, participants complete surveys about neck disability and smartphone addiction, followed by muscle and pain threshold measurements. Researchers will analyze these data to quantify mechanical muscle properties and neck disability related to smartphone use. The study's primary outcome is the quantitative assessment of muscle mechanics, with secondary outcomes including neck disability and addiction scale scores. Participation involves a single evaluation visit with no ongoing treatment or follow-up required.

Eligibility Criteria

Eligible

You may qualify if you...

  • Aged between 18-30 years
  • Actively using a smartphone
  • Volunteer consent provided
Not Eligible

You will not qualify if you...

  • Any diagnosed cervical spine pathology
  • Neurological, rheumatological, or psychiatric disease
  • Previous cervical surgery
  • Lack of cooperation or inability to understand instructions
